A bipartisan pair of lawmakers called on the heads of the House Appropriations Committee to consider additional funding support for border community first responders.

A bipartisan pair of lower chamber lawmakers are calling on the heads of the House Appropriations Committee to consider additional funding support to first responders in border communities. Reps. Ruben Gallego, D-Ariz., and Michael McCaul, R-Texas, sent a letter to House Appropriations Committee Chairwoman Kay Granger, R-Texas, and ranking member Rosa DeLauro, D-Conn., requesting supplemental funding for first responders in communities hit hard by the southern border crisis.

Across the country, local officials, including police departments, fire departments, and Emergency Operations Centers , face significant resource strains related to the migrant crisis,' the pair of lawmakers continued.
